Have a UK 2000 S2000 and need a decent system. I have 6" Speakers JL Audio out of my last car and would love to put these in the front doors, will they fit ??

Also have an amp and sub plus head unit and autochanger...will the sub sound OK ?

I have seen many S2000 on here with Subs in the wheel well which are cool but I have a box which I quite fancy keeping as it is perfect for the sub and can be removed very easy.

I believe the front will hold speakers up to 6.5" depending on the depth, so you will just have to make or buy an adapter ring for them to fit. Lucid sells a nice one.

About the speaker box, I can't see why you wouldnt be able to use any box you want, so long as it fits in the trunk and won't slide around.

You should not have any problems getting the JL's installed. You may need a spacer between the speaker and the door to gain some mounting depth, but that's not a big deal. Most people that are using subs are trying to retain as much usable trunk space as possible. If you're willing to sacrafice the trunk space for your existing box, then go for it! You can always build/buy a different box down the road if you find the need. You may also need to fix some rattles that will creep up when you put a sub in the trunk. The most common seems to be the plastic roof well. I can't comment on personal experience, as my sub hasn't shipped yet.
